I'm still testing out and assessing CloudStack but I'd like to use CloudStack in our University research environment to allow some of our researchers to spin up VMs as needed. As such, we'd like to leverage our existing SSO infrastructure which is currently hosted on Azure AD. I've got a build environment set up and modified the code to prepend "id" to the random request ID. I can confirm that works as a fix and it's indeed the starting digits in the request IDs that are the issue. Would you be against the idea of having something like a "saml2.sp.prepend" config key that an admin could specify in global settings? -- This is an automated message from the Apache Git Service.
